Giuseppe Paterno grew up loving books but never got the chance to study beyond basic schooling

This week, the former railway worker stepped forward to receive his diploma and the traditional laurel wreath awarded to Italian students when they graduate, applauded by his family, teachers and fellow students more than 70 years his junior.
